diff --git a/src/controllers/account_controller.rs b/src/controllers/account_controller.rs index f365a6f..9d06c63 100644 --- a/src/controllers/account_controller.rs +++ b/src/controllers/account_controller.rs @@ -68,9 +68,8 @@ pub fn create(r: &mut HttpRequestHandler) -> RequestResult { /// Sign in user pub fn login_user(request: &mut HttpRequestHandler) -> RequestResult { - // TODO : remove fallbacks - let email = request.post_string_with_fallback("mail", "userMail")?; - let password = request.post_string_with_fallback("password", "userPassword")?; + let email = request.post_email("mail")?; + let password = request.post_string("password")?; if !mailchecker::is_valid(&email) { request.bad_request("Invalid email!".to_string())?;